Default air bags

Does anyone know about the wiring for seat air bags. I want to change a seat but the previous owner cut the connector off and I'm left with two unmarked yellow wires inside the ribbed protective cable. In the airbag unit these wires clip into the end of the 'detonating' unit and there doesn't appear to be any other electrical components. These wires serve two purposes. One as a test circuit linked to the airbag warning light and secondly to detonate the unit. Are they seperate circuits or does the set up use low current for the test and a much higher to trigger?
Tried two local Subaru dealers but neither much help as both gave different advice.
